Now, before we get into the various whats and wheres of how you can watch 'Matthew Berdyck’s Blame Reagan' right now, here are some details about the Fillmore Street Films documentary flick.
Released March 13th, 2013, 'Matthew Berdyck’s Blame Reagan' stars Matthew Berdyck The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 13 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from respected users.
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Hailed as the first-ever, first-person immersion documentary about homelessness in film history, Blame Reagan is an eye-opening look into the hidden world of homelessness. Matthew lived on the streets of cities all along the west coast, for eighteen months, to create this film, risking his life and digging in the dirt to hand the world a gritty, disturbing but very real account of the suffering of a homeless disabled person living in the richest country in the world." .
